3. Types of Air Pumps in Industrial Settings
Understanding the various types of air pumps is vital for selecting the right solution for your industrial needs.
3.1 Positive Displacement Pumps
Positive displacement pumps work by trapping a fixed amount of fluid and forcing it into the discharge pipe. This type of pump is ideal for applications requiring consistent flow rates and pressures, making it suitable for various industrial processes.
3.2 Dynamic Pumps
Dynamic pumps, such as centrifugal pumps, utilize rotational energy to move fluids. These pumps are perfect for applications where high flow rates are necessary. They offer operational flexibility and can be used in numerous industries, including chemical processing and water treatment.
3.3 Vacuum Pumps
Vacuum pumps are essential for creating a vacuum in a system, which is critical in various industrial applications, such as packaging and vacuum forming. Their ability to efficiently remove air and other gases enhances product quality and operational efficiency.
4. Innovative Technologies in Air Pumps
Recent advancements in technology have led to the development of innovative air pump solutions that significantly enhance industrial efficiency.
4.1 Variable Frequency Drive (VFD) Technology
VFD technology allows for precise control of pump speeds, enabling energy savings by adjusting the motor’s speed according to the demand. This innovation results in reduced wear and tear on the pump, extending its lifespan and minimizing maintenance needs.
4.2 Smart Pump Systems
Smart pump systems integrate IoT technology to monitor and optimize pump performance in real-time. These systems provide valuable data insights, allowing for predictive maintenance and operational adjustments to maximize efficiency.
5. Applications of Air Pumps in Different Industries
Air pumps find diverse applications across various industrial sectors, showcasing their versatility and importance.
5.1 Manufacturing
In manufacturing, air pumps are used for material transfer, pneumatic conveying, and equipment cooling. Their reliability and efficiency contribute to smoother production processes and reduced downtime.
5.2 Food and Beverage
The food and beverage industry relies on air pumps for processes such as filtration, carbonation, and packaging. Ensuring the safety and quality of products is paramount, making advanced air pump solutions essential in this sector.
5.3 Pharmaceutical
In the pharmaceutical industry, air pumps facilitate processes like vacuum drying and material handling. The precision and reliability of these pumps are crucial for maintaining product integrity and compliance with regulatory standards.

7. Challenges and Considerations in Adopting Air Pump Technologies
While innovative air pump solutions present numerous advantages, several challenges must be considered during adoption.
- **Initial Cost**: The upfront investment in advanced air pump technologies can be substantial. However, the long-term savings often justify the initial expense.
- **Training Requirements**: Implementing new technologies may necessitate employee training to ensure proper operation and maintenance.
- **Integration with Existing Systems**: Compatibility with existing processes and systems can pose challenges, requiring careful planning and implementation strategies.
